高效短信发送API接口使用指南
在现代商业环境中,短信营销和通知服务已经成为企业与客户沟通的重要手段。针对关键词“”,本文将为您详细介绍如何使用该API接口,实现高效率的短信发送功能。
第1步:账户注册与API密钥获取
首先,您需要在聚合数据官网注册一个账户。完成注册后,系统会引导您进入用户中心,在那里您将找到API密钥。
注意:确保您的账户已经通过验证,未完成验证的账户无法使用API接口。此外,保管好您的API密钥,避免泄露给他人。
第2步:了解API接口文档
在开始调用API之前,熟悉官方提供的API文档是至关重要的。这份文档详细列出了每个接口的功能、请求格式及返回结果。
- 访问聚合数据的官方网站,找到“API文档”区域。
- 阅读各个接口的功能描述,尤其关注与短信发送相关的API接口。
- 理解每个参数的作用,有助于您更好地构建请求。
第3步:准备开发环境
根据您使用的编程语言准备开发环境。聚合数据API支持多种语言(如Python、Java、PHP等)。这里以Python为例,介绍安装和依赖流程。
pip install requests
这条命令将安装一个流行的HTTP库,方便您处理API请求。
第4步:编写发送短信的代码
以下是使用Python调用短信发送API的基本示例代码:
import requests
url = "https://api.juhe.cn/sms/send"
params = {
"tpl_id": "您的模板ID",
"tpl_value": "code=123456", 替换为动态数据
"key": "您的API密钥",
"mobile": "接收者的手机号码",
}
response = requests.get(url, params=params)
data = response.json
print(data)
此段代码向指定手机号发送模板短信,其参数包括:模板ID、模板变量值、API密钥及手机号码。
第5步:处理API返回结果
在发送请求之后,您需要处理API返回的数据。返回的JSON数据通常包含成功与否的信息。
if data["error_code"] == 0:
print("短信发送成功")
else:
print(f"错误代码:{data['error_code']}, 错误信息:{data['reason']}")
记得根据返回的错误代码进行相应的调试,以便解决潜在的问题。
第6步:测试与上线
在开发完成后,一定要进行充分的测试。尝试不同的随机电话号码、模板参数,确保系统在多种情况下都能正常运行。
测试提示:注意发送频率和限制,过快的请求可能会导致接口被限制。根据文档中的说明设置合理的请求速度。
常见错误及解决方案
- 错误代码 10001:说明请求参数不完整。确保证所有必要的参数都已传入,尤其是API密钥和接收号码。
- 错误代码 10002:表示API密钥错误。重新检查您的API密钥是否输入正确。
- 错误代码 10003:短信发送频率超限。请降低您的请求频率。
- 错误代码 10004:目标手机号码格式不正确。手机号码应为11位数字,并且以“1”开头。
最佳实践与优化建议
在应用程序中实现短信发送功能后,以下最佳实践将有助于提升您的用户体验:
- 用户同意:在发送短信之前,请确保用户已明确同意接收此类信息。
- 模板管理:合理设计短信模板,使其简洁明了,避免冗余信息,并根据实际需求进行动态填充值。
- 数据分析:定期分析短信发送效果,收集用户反馈,并根据数据结果进行相应优化。
总结
通过以上几个步骤,您应该能够顺利地设置并使用聚合数据的无接码短信发送API接口。在使用过程中,要注意API的调用限制和错误处理,以确保您的应用程序的稳定性和用户体验。
希望这份指南能帮助您高效实现短信发送功能,提升您的业务沟通效率!如有其他问题,请参考聚合数据的官方文档或联系客服获取支持。